Delhi's activist-turned-Chief Minister Arvind Kejriwal on Tuesday described the scrapping of section 66A by the Supreme Court "a big day for freedom of speech and expression".
The Aam Aadmi Party leader said this in a tweet only hours after the apex court ruled that 66A of the Information Technology Act violated freedom of expression of citizens and struck it down.
